Drove a GTO and C6
A friend and I went to the GM autoshow in motion at arlington racetrack today. They had a bunch of cars that you could test drive around a cone course. You have to drive one luxury or passenger car before you can drive the C6, we chose the GTO. The GTO is a has a great interior and the seats hold you in really well. The tranny was kinda notchym but the clutch was great. The car handles decent, but understeers at the limit. I had the tires squeeling pretty hard around the course, as well as my friend. He got a warning for driving too fast.
Next, onto the C6. The interior is really improved over the C5. The plastics are great as well as the ergonomics. The clutch and tranny worked very well, but was kindy notchy as well. The LS2 has great low end torque, but I was expecting a little more. Maybe its because I have been driving around a ATI procharged C5 and my butt dyno is off. The C6 track was a little longer than the others, so I really got to wring it out. The suspension is much improved and the car feels lighter on its feet. The car will still understeer at the limits, but I just applied gas and rotated the car. I had the tires squeeling around most of the cource. The brakes are very responsive, providing good feel and easy modulation. Overall, the car is much improved and very close to a C5 Z06. I wish they had a Z51 equiped car that I could have tested. It
